WHAT IS SIGNLLM? SignLLM is an open-source large language model specifically designed to understand and generate sign language. It bridges the gap between spoken/written language AI and deaf accessibility by providing free, advanced LLM capabilities tailored for sign language processing. WHO IS IT FOR? • Developers building accessibility tools for deaf communities • Researchers working on sign language recognition and generation • Organizations creating inclusive communication platforms • Educational institutions developing sign language technology • Anyone interested in making AI more inclusive and accessible KEY FEATURES • Open-source LLM architecture for sign language processing • Free access to model weights and documentation • Support for sign language understanding and generation • Community-driven development and contributions • Integration capabilities for accessibility applications PROS • Completely free and open-source • Addresses underserved accessibility needs • Active community support and collaboration • No vendor lock-in • Enables innovation in deaf technology CONS • Smaller ecosystem compared to mainstream LLMs • May have limited language variety coverage • Requires technical expertise to implement • Ongoing development means potential API changes • Smaller training dataset compared to general-purpose models
